stigmem-node contains an insecure default configuration vulnerability that allows federation traffic to traverse networks without mTLS protection when non-loopback endpoints are enabled. Operators who explicitly disabled mTLS while binding federation to non-loopback addresses expose federation traffic to cleartext interception and man-in-the-middle attacks.
